Honoring our Veterans
Senator Velmanette Montgomery
November 11, 2015
Veterans Day is always very special to me. I appreciate that our nation takes a day to recognize and honor the services provided by so many men and women over the years, many with their lives.
This year I was fortunate to be able to observe this solemn day in the company of fellow elected officials in a very impressive ceremony in Carroll Park, in Brooklyn. A drum corps and a flag corps presented colors at a memorial to the WWI veterans, and prayers and remembrances were offered for all our Service men and women, living and gone before us.
I was also able to present a Proclamation to one of our local veterans, Buddy Scotto. Buddy is a long time friend who has helped to shape Brooklyn in so many ways for many years, and I look forward to working with him for many more.
